Assists in the design and execution of collateral to support national corporate sponsorship programs. Creates graphics to meet specific promotional needs, using a variety of mediums to achieve the desired strategic outcomes that secure new and increase support from national corporate sponsors.
Areas of Responsibility:
- Creates designs, concepts, and layouts based on knowledge of layout principles and esthetic design concepts.
- Determines size and arrangement of illustrative material and copy, aligning the style with the Make-A-Wish and sponsor brand guidelines.
- Coordinates with members of the Brand Advancement and Corporate Alliances teams to create synergy within all campaigns.
- Maintains working files and archives artwork.
- Follows Brand Advancement workflow process including use of project management tool for all projects.
- Works with project managers to ensure projects meet deadlines and the needs of target audiences.
- Serves as liaison to printing/production vendors to ensure materials created are delivered to the vendors in the appropriate format, and are printed professionally and to the precise printing specifications.
- Participates in creative brainstorming sessions with other members of Brand Advancement, Corporate Alliances, and other teams within the organization.
- Assists freelance workers to ensure clarity, professionalism, high quality, and a consistent voice and style in all Make-A-Wish materials.
- Time permitting, designs logos, publications and other collateral as requested by Creative Services Director or Graphics Manager.
- Design custom corporate sponsor proposals, presentations, and reports materials to effectively showcase ROI for the sponsor, key metrics that align with the goals and objectives of sponsorship and impact utilizing the corporate brand attributes and campaign design elements.
